Product Overview

Category: Integrated Circuit (IC)

Use: Voltage Regulator

Characteristics: - Low dropout voltage - High output current capability - Excellent line and load regulation - Thermal shutdown protection - Short circuit current limit - Fast transient response

Package: SOT-223

Essence: The RT9163-33GGT is a voltage regulator IC designed to provide a stable output voltage with low dropout. It is commonly used in various electronic devices to regulate the voltage supplied to sensitive components.

Packaging/Quantity: The RT9163-33GGT is available in a SOT-223 package, which is a surface-mount package with four pins. It is typically sold in reels or tubes containing multiple units.

Specifications

  • Input Voltage Range: 2.5V - 6V
  • Output Voltage: 3.3V
  • Output Current: Up to 1A
  • Dropout Voltage: 300mV @ 1A
  • Line Regulation: ±0.2%
  • Load Regulation: ±0.4%
  • Quiescent Current: 80μA
  • Operating Temperature Range: -40°C to +85°C

Functional Features

  • Low dropout voltage ensures efficient power conversion even when the input voltage is close to the output voltage.
  • High output current capability allows it to power a wide range of electronic components.
  • Excellent line and load regulation ensure a stable output voltage under varying input and load conditions.
  • Thermal shutdown protection prevents the IC from overheating and damaging itself or other components.
  • Short circuit current limit protects the IC and connected devices from excessive current during a short circuit event.
  • Fast transient response enables quick adjustment to changes in load requirements.

Advantages

  • Compact SOT-223 package allows for easy integration into small electronic devices.
  • Low dropout voltage minimizes power dissipation, increasing overall efficiency.
  • Wide operating temperature range makes it suitable for various environmental conditions.
  • Robust protection features enhance the reliability and longevity of the IC.

Disadvantages

  • Limited output voltage options (specifically designed for 3.3V output).
  • Requires external capacitors for stability and noise reduction.

Working Principles

The RT9163-33GGT is a linear voltage regulator that uses a pass transistor to regulate the output voltage. It compares the output voltage with a reference voltage and adjusts the pass transistor accordingly to maintain a stable output voltage. The dropout voltage is minimized by using a low resistance pass transistor.
